This is a draft item of legislation. This draft has since been made as a UK Statutory Instrument: The Sub-national Transport Body (Transport for the North) Regulations 2018 No. 103
3.—(1) There are to be at least 4 meetings per year of the members of TfN.
(2) A question to be decided by TfN on the matters in sub-paragraph (3) may be decided only if agreed by both—
(a)members who together hold at least 75% of the votes in a weighted vote, and
(b)a simple majority of the members.
(3) The matters are—
(a)the approval or revision of TfN’s transport strategy,
(b)the approval of TfN’s annual budget, and
(c)the adoption of and any changes to TfN’s constitution.
(4) Except as provided in these Regulations, a question to be decided by TfN on any other matter may be decided only if agreed by members who together hold more than 50% of the votes in a weighted vote.
(5) For the purposes of this regulation, a “weighted vote” is—
(a)in the case of a question about the management of the Northern or TransPennine Express franchises, a vote in which the number of votes to be cast by a member appointed by a constituent authority is determined by multiplying the percentage of passenger miles on the Northern and TransPennine Express franchises that are in the area of the constituent authority by ten, and, if the result is not a whole number, rounding to the nearest whole number, and
(b)in any other case, a vote in which the number of votes to be cast by a member appointed by a constituent authority is determined by dividing the total resident population of the area of that constituent authority at the relevant date as estimated by the Statistics Board by 200,000, and, if the result is not a whole number, rounding up to the next whole number.
(6) For the purposes of sub-paragraph (5)(b) the relevant date in relation to a vote is 30th June in the financial year which commenced two years before the financial year in which the vote takes place.
(7) If a vote is tied on any matter it is deemed not to have been carried.
(8) In this paragraph, references to “members”—
(a)are to the members present at a meeting of TfN who are entitled to vote in relation to the question to be decided, and
(b)include references to “substitute members”.
